Donald Trump hides from an Iranian assassination threat inside an airline catering cart while the sign above him is rewritten to read Air Force Run.
Jonathan Brown, PoliticalCartoons.com
A wheeled airline catering cart occupies the center of the frame, painted in the livery of the presidential aircraft: white upper body, curved blue lower panel, and UNITED STATES OF AMERICA lettered down the side. Its full height door hangs open on empty wire shelving. Above it a pale blue placard reads AIR FORCE ONE, with ONE struck through in red and RUN! added beside that word in the same color. Two neckties poke out from between the casters underneath, one of them the long red tie Donald Trump is known for, the only trace of the men folded up inside. The drawing responds to reports that Trump sheltered in an airline galley cart against an assassination threat traced to Iran, turning the most recognizable branding in presidential aviation into an instruction to flee. Jonathan Brown signed the lower right corner alongside inkstains.com and Cagle.com/brown.
